The next step is the construction of the neck (which features some lights) and the mount for the head. I decided to make the head removable so I can access the electronics through the opening in the neck. From the movie it does not become clear on which sides of the droid the lights in the neck are placed - I decided to put them on the front and on the left and right sides. In the movie, the lights in the neck appear to be blue (at 20:58). In another scene (at 1:36:24) they also seem to be red. Although this might be some reflection, I decided to use red and blue lights for my H015 (I am using RGB LEDs where only the red and blue elements are connected).
The neck construction starts with two layers of cardboard which are glued to the body. To those, I glue some white transparent plastic (taken from a gallon bottle of vinegar) to diffuses the light of the individual LEDs. Five more layers of cardboard are added to provide support for the head.
